.NET8 Identity EF Core MySql 마이그레이션 문제와 해결방법

ef provider는 pomelo 사용했습니다. 아직 pomelo 8버전은 아직 베타 버전이라 이런 문제가 있는 것 같습니다.

커넥션 스트링만 바꾼상태에서 dotnet ef database update 진행하면 마이그레이션이 실패합니다.

대략적인 원인은 프로바이더에서 스트링 멤버를 죄다 TEXT로 잡아줍니다.
해결방법은 마이그레이션 파일을 직접 맞게 다른 스트링타입으로 바꿔주시면 됩니다.
우선 TEXT를 다 VARCHAR(길이)로 잡아주니 문제없이 마이그레이션 되는 것을 확인했습니다.
